How to fill out the 2781, Request to Transfer MET Educational Benefits - State of Michigan

Filling out the 2781 form can seem daunting, but this guide provides a professional and supportive approach to streamline the process. The form is necessary for transferring educational benefits under the Michigan Education Trust, and understanding each section will ensure a smooth submission.

Follow the steps to complete the form accurately and efficiently.

  1. Click the 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the form and open it in your editor.
  2. Begin filling in the 'Original Beneficiary' section. Provide the original beneficiary's name, relationship to the new beneficiary, street address, Social Security number, email address, and contact numbers. Also, indicate the number of years or semesters of educational benefits purchased.
  3. Enter the 'New Beneficiary' details. Include their name, Social Security number, address, date of birth, and contact information. Also, specify the number of years or credit hours of educational benefits requested for transfer.
  4. Answer the questions regarding the new beneficiary's acceptance of the original graduation year. Indicate whether the new beneficiary is currently enrolled in a college or university, and if you wish to activate the contract now.
  5. Both the original and new beneficiaries must sign the form on the designated sections, ensuring all signatures are notarized.
  6. After completing the form, review all entries for accuracy. You can then save your changes, download, print, or share the completed form before mailing it to the Michigan Education Trust.

MET contracts offer three purchase options: Lump Sum, Pay-As-You-Go, and Monthly. The Pay-As-You-Go option allows purchases of credit hours. From December 1, 2021 to September 30, 2022, prices range from $120 per credit hour for a community college contract to $750 per credit hour for a full benefits contract.

MET is a 529 prepaid tuition savings program which allows you to pay for future higher education at today's price. MET is flexible, transferable and even refundable. MET is specific to tuition, it does not pay for room and board or books.

Activate Your MET Contract When a student is ready to utilize their MET contract, the student must contact MET to activate the contract. MET must also be notified of the college the student is attending. Students must notify MET of their intent to attend the U-M prior to the beginning of their first term of attendance.
